How to Form an LLC in Missouri

Missouri, popularly known as The Show-Me State, is a business-friendly state with a population of 6,204,710. The Nominal Gross Domestic Product (in millions) of Missouri is $392,935 according to a 2022 study, which has been said to be increased over the past year. Hence, starting your business in Missouri will always be a good option. If you choose the state capital, Jefferson City, to start your LLC, you might get more tax and other benefits.

To form an LLC in Missouri, you need to follow some basic steps, including getting an LLC name, appointing your Missouri Registered Agent, filing the Missouri Articles of Organization, creating Missouri LLC operating agreement, and finally getting an EIN for filing required taxes.

You can do that on your own. However, it is always recommended to get a professional person on board to guide you through. These steps are crucial and sensitive. You must complete everything to avoid canceling your formation process. Hence, having a professional LLC formation service for your LLC is better.

Why Missouri is One of the Best Places for Business

One of the main reasons Missouri is an attractive destination for businesses is its strategic location. Being centrally located in the country allows for easy access to both coasts, making it a prime location for distribution and logistics operations. Whether a company is looking to reach customers in the Midwest or across the country, Missouri’s central location provides a competitive advantage in terms of efficiency and cost savings.

In addition to its strategic location, Missouri also boasts a skilled workforce that is well-equipped to meet the demands of today’s business landscape. The state is home to several top universities and technical schools, producing a talent pool that is highly educated and trained in a variety of fields. From engineering to marketing, Missouri’s workforce is diverse and capable of meeting the needs of businesses across various industries.

Moreover, Missouri is known for its business-friendly environment, with low taxes and regulations that create a favorable climate for companies looking to establish or grow their operations. The state offers various incentives and programs to support businesses, ranging from tax credits for job creation to grants for research and development. These initiatives help businesses thrive and expand, contributing to the overall economic growth and prosperity of the state.

Another key factor that makes Missouri an ideal choice for businesses is its infrastructure. The state has a vast network of highways, railroads, and airports that provide easy access to markets both domestically and internationally. Additionally, Missouri is home to several major cities, including St. Louis and Kansas City, which offer a range of amenities and resources for businesses to take advantage of.

Finally, Missouri prides itself on its strong sense of community and collaboration, which is evident through its numerous business associations and networking opportunities. Entrepreneurs and business owners in Missouri have access to a supportive ecosystem that fosters growth and innovation, with organizations dedicated to helping businesses succeed and thrive.
